The first dental degree was awarded to a student in 1912. [2] A site for a purpose-built dental hospital was selected in Lower Maudlin Street and construction started in 1935. [2] The dental hospital and school opened in 1939 and was extended in 1965, 1973, 1985 and 1995. [2] A major expansion and refurbishment was completed in 2009. [4]

Dighton's location has long made it a crossroads for travel. The "Old Bristol Path" took early settlers from the Pilgrim settlement in Plymouth, Massachusetts to Bristol, Rhode Island, the home of Massasoit. [3]: 1 A ferry took travelers across the Taunton River. [3]: 34 Later, a stage coach ran through Dighton, connecting Taunton and Bristol.

Fall River is a city in Bristol County, Massachusetts, United States.Fall River's population was 94,000 at the 2020 United States census, [5] making it the tenth-largest city in the state, and the second-largest municipality in the county behind New Bedford.
